Holders & concentration
Concentration is the standard due-diligence read on attention-driven assets: the fewer wallets control the supply, the more one seller can move the price. Exchange wallets pool many customers, so labelled exchange rows are not single holders.

What is The Graph's supply?
The Graph has a circulating supply of 10.80B GRT and a total supply of 10.80B GRT. This asset's supply can't be read from the chain in a single call, so the circulating figure is data powered by CoinStats rather than our own chain read — labelled as such on this page.
How is the GRT price here computed?
The GRT price on this page is TheDistributed's own reference price: we take DEX pool prices from DexScreener and weight them by pool liquidity, rather than using an exchange feed. The full method and labels are documented on our methodology page.
Does The Graph have a market cap?
We don't label a market cap for The Graph because its circulating supply can't be independently verified. Instead this page shows a total-supply valuation of $147.1M — the reference price times the total on-chain supply — labelled as exactly that.
Is The Graph its own blockchain?
No — The Graph (GRT) is a token issued on a host blockchain rather than a native coin. We track it by its verified canonical contract, and its on-chain figures are read from that contract.
